17th C English Antique Oak Box Settle


A 17th Century antique box settle with possible links to George Bernard Shaw, the famous playwright.
The settle was apparently owned by the family of Shaw's wife's, Charlotte Townsend. A paper label inside reads "This settle came to grandfather WG Wood 1890 from the townsend family, Miss Charlotte Townsend married GB Shaw. Horace Payne townsend (father of Charlotte) Derry House in the Parish of Rosecarbery, Co Cork, WG Wood was auctioneer in Skibbereen, Co. Cork"
With lunette carved cresting rail above two panels incorporating serpents over a dividing rail inscribed "Reste and bee thankful"and three further panels below with arches encompassing foliate forms and floral rossettes, flanked either side by chamfered uprights, tipped with turned finials.
The arms rest upon baluster turned posts over box seat. With hinged lid lifting to reveal a void interior. Identical carving can be seen to the front of the box seat mirroring the arches, floral forms and rossettes above.
Original butterfly hinge to box seat on right (the left is a later replacment). Lock and key fully function.
Excellent colour and patina.
